Output 31b793c85b523e74d380067b287224f7f73807efe1b42afdfd38305aa03d38d6:3

value
131000
script pubkey
OP_0 OP_PUSHBYTES_20 3a5b90926f305ebc191180291326d85e424feeae
address
bc1q8fdepyn0xp0tcxg3sq53xfkctepylm4wx6sl62
transaction
31b793c85b523e74d380067b287224f7f73807efe1b42afdfd38305aa03d38d6